Human anatomy, blood drawing techniques, and laboratory procedures are some of the first courses to be taken, and there'll be courses in lab procedures and theoretical training. It requires between four months and one year to complete the training and studies include physiology, socializing with people, and legal facets of blood collection, Universal and Standard Safety Precautions and blood collection techniques. Phlebotomists will even learn blood sampling procedures. Most generally used is venipuncture, but phlebotomists will learn other techniques that are used in newborns, children, some adults, as well as the elderly.

Anyone in this range can take up cortication examinations rather than the training. Most needles have a unique sleeve or cannula that prevents major blood loss as the needle is added. After the phlebotomist has placed the needle inside the vessel, a group tube is attached that creates the negative pressure needed to draw blood out of the body.
